Payroll Assistant - 6 Month FTC

Location: Newcastle Upon Tyne - Hybrid (3 dpw on-site)
Salary: £29K Per Annum
Benefits: Excellent Benefits

The Client: Curo are Partnering with a Global Organisation, consisting of Designers, Engineers and Consultants, dedicated to sustainable development. They support their clients to solve the most complex challenges, turning their ideas into reality, leveraging the latest technology.

The Candidate: You will have solid experience in payroll processing, including international payrolls, and a good understanding of statutory absence and tax upload procedures. You will be detail-oriented, Excel-proficient, and able to work accurately under pressure. Experience in a Shared Service Centre and strong communication skills are a plus.

The Role: An exciting role supporting monthly payroll processing across the UK, United Arab Emirates, India, and Kenya. The role involves handling starters, leavers, statutory absences, tax uploads, and reconciliations. It's ideal for someone with strong payroll experience, Excel skills, and a keen eye for detail, who thrives in a fast-paced, collaborative environment.

The Opportunity:

  • Starters, leavers
  • One-off payments, season ticket and bicycle loans
  • Checking payroll changes
  • Tax uploads
  • Sickness Absence
  • Statutory Absence including Birthing parent and Shared Parental
  • International Payroll Processing
  • Reporting and reconciliations
  • Payroll reconciliations/Data cleansing
  • Third party payments
  • Assisting with correspondence and customer service
  • Ad-Hoc tasks as and when required

Requirements:

  • Demonstrate strong payroll processing experience
  • Have a solid working knowledge and experience of Microsoft Excel
  • Be able to work with an exceptionally high degree of accuracy and to tight timescales
  • Have an awareness or experience of working in a Shared Service Centre environment
  • Demonstrate an understanding of payroll legislation and processes
  • Be able to create and review procedures
  • Possess process improvement experience
  • Demonstrate excellent written and spoken communication and interpersonal skills
